{Beyond the Moon by Catherine Taylor}

Both are patients of the same hospital, separated by almost a century. The FMC is a psychiatric patient in the present day, while the MMC is a World War I soldier suffering from shell shock. In the hospital’s abandoned wing, she discovers a time portal and begins visiting him regularly.

I did some research and I found it.

At first I found {Heart of The Wolf (Black River Moon #1) by A. Mariposa. Plot fits almost perfectly but it was published in 2024. The book I was looking for was at least 10 year old. There were other minor differences, like sub/dom, ex-miliatary hero, slow-burn, clifhanger.

The OG book was a complete story and the 2nd instalment was about different couple in the same pack.

So, I kept digging and found {Mark Of the Wolf (Wolves of Black River) by T.L. Shreffler}. It's the book I was looking for.

I seems like A. Mariposa & T.L. Shreffler are one person and the original version was rewritten and republished with 300+ pages added.
